LoweComputer Science DepartmentUniversity of British ColumbiaVancouver, , V6T 1Z4, of the International Conference onComputer Vision,Corfu (Sept. 1999)An Object Recognition system has been developed that uses anew class of Local image Features . The Features are invariantto image scaling, translation, and rotation, and partially in-variant to illumination changes and affine or 3D Features share similar properties with neurons in in-ferior temporal cortex that are used for Object recognitionin primate vision.
